Brookhaven (Miss.) CC Opens Laney’s Bar and Grill
The property’s previous restaurant, Porches of Brookhaven, closed its doors on January 1 after parting amicably with the operator. The new pub-style restaurant, which has a new menu and revamped bar, is now open and will introduce itself to the public through a lunchtime buffet on January 7. The new year brought a big change…

Under New Ownership, Brookhaven (Miss.) CC Adds Restaurant
Porches, which has another location in Wesson, Miss., will serve hearty, Southern dishes with a full bar, and will open to the public on February 2. “I think it’s a Godsend that we have Porches coming,” said co-owner Ricky Salyer. “Our goal is to make Brookhaven Country Club great again.”
